Benchmarks suggest Motorola XT1032 could be Moto G
Nov 11th 2013, 14:35, by Scott Webster

Benchmarks spotted at GFXBench’s website may shed some added light on the upcoming Moto G smartphone. Popping up on our radar in the past, the XT1032 has the makings of what should be a low-cost experience. Specifications figure to include a 720p HD display with a 1.2GHz quad-core Qualcomm Snapdragon MSM8226 (S4) and Adreno 305 GPU. Spied running 4.4 KitKat, the device (codenamed "Falcon") could be one of the first non-Nexus handsets on the market with the brand new version of Android.

xt-1032-bench

We’re expecting to see the Moto G unveiled in but a few day’s time; all of the unanswered questions will be… well, answered.
